Portland Freight Advisory Committee Meeting

Online/Virtual Portland, OR

The Portland Freight Advisory Committee, formed February 2003, serves as an advisory group to the Portland Bureau of Transportation and City Council on issues related to freight mobility. Transportation Policy Alternatives Committee (Metro)

Portland, OR

The Transportation Policy Alternatives Committee provides technical input to the Joint Policy Advisory Committee on Transportation on transportation planning and funding priorities for the region. TPAC reviews regional plans and federally funded transportation projects, and advises area leaders on transportation investment priorities and policies related to transportation. Portland Bicycle Advisory Committee meeting

Online/Virtual Portland, OR

The 20-member volunteer Bicycle Advisory Committee (BAC) meets monthly (the second Tuesday of every month) to review projects of interest to cyclists and discuss bike issues. Multnomah County Bicycle and Pedestrian Community Advisory Committee Meeting

Online/Virtual Portland, OR

The Multnomah County Bicycle and Pedestrian Community Advisory Committee (BPCAC) represents citizens of Multnomah County regarding bicycle and pedestrian issues. The committee is made up of citizens from around the county with a strong interest in bicycle and pedestrian issues.
